Discover the wonders of Rincón de la Vieja Volcano National Park with a professional naturalist guide. This is a self-drive experience: you bring your own vehicle, and your guide joins you in the passenger seat for the journey. Meet in Liberia City, welcome your guide aboard, and enjoy a scenic countryside drive as they share stories about local history, culture, and the volcanic landscapes you’re about to explore.

Upon arrival at the park, take a moment to refresh and use the restrooms before setting out. The adventure begins on a two-mile loop trail designed to showcase the park’s remarkable contrasts. Stroll beneath lush tropical forest canopies where monkeys, toucans, iguanas, and other wildlife are often spotted. Pause to admire a seasonal waterfall tumbling through greenery—perfect for photos.

As the trail curves into the park’s dry forest, the terrain changes dramatically—steaming fumaroles bubble from the earth, mud volcanoes gurgle, and the scent of sulfur hints at the geothermal power beneath your feet. Your guide interprets the ecosystems, volcanic activity, and cultural stories tied to this rugged landscape, offering a richer understanding of Costa Rica’s natural heritage.

After the hike, settle back into your vehicle with your guide for the return drive to Liberia City. Along the way, your guide can recommend favorite local restaurants if you’d like to stop for authentic Costa Rican cuisine.

This experience includes the national park entrance fee, toll road access, a bilingual naturalist guide, and one bottle of water per person—everything you need for an immersive and worry-free volcano adventure, while enjoying the flexibility of your own transportation.
